Ingredients

For the Cookies

  • 1 c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 1 cup brown sugar
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1/2 cup Baileys Irish Cream
  • 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
  • 3 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 2 cups chocolate chips

How to Make Baileys Irish Cream Chocolate Chip Cookies

Step 1: Preheat the Oven

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). This ensures your cookies will bake evenly from the moment they go in.

Step 2: Mix the Wet Ingredients

In a mixing bowl, cream together the softened butter, brown sugar, and granulated sugar until smooth.
1. Add the eggs one at a time, mixing well after each addition.
2. Pour in the Baileys Irish Cream and vanilla extract, then blend until fully combined.

Step 3: Combine Dry Ingredients

In another b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, baking soda, and salt until evenly mixed.

Step 4: Combine Wet and Dry Mixtures

Gradually add the dry ingredient mixture to the wet mixture.
1. Stir until just combined; do not overmix.
2. Fold in the chocolate chips gently.

Step 5: Bake the Cookies

Line your baking sheet with parchment paper.
1. Drop rounded tablespoons of dough onto the sheet, spacing them about 2 inches apart.
2. Bake for 10-12 minutes or until they are lightly golden around the edges.

Step 6: Cool and Enjoy

Remove cookies from the oven and let them cool on the baking sheet for about 5 min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ely. Enjoy your Baileys Irish Cream Chocolate Chip Cookies warm or store them for later!

How to Perfect Baileys Irish Cream Chocolate Chip Cookies

To achieve the perfect texture and flavor in your Baileys Irish Cream Chocolate Chip Cookies, follow these helpful tips.

  • Use Room Temperature Ingredients: Ensure your butter and eggs are at room temperature for better mixing and texture.
  • Chill the Dough: Refrigerate your dough for at least 30 minutes before baking. This helps improve flavor and prevents spreading.
  • Measure Flour Accurately: Use a kitchen scale or spoon and level technique to avoid too much flour, which can lead to dry cookies.
  • Watch Baking Time: Bake just until the edges are golden brown. The centers should look slightly underbaked; they will firm up while cooling.
  • Add Extra Chocolate Chips: For extra gooeyness, fold in some additional chocolate chips right before baking.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

When baking Baileys Irish Cream Chocolate Chip Cookies, avoiding common pitfalls will ensure your cookies turn out perfectly every time.

  • Bold measurements: Miscalculating ingredients can ruin the texture. Always use precise measurements for flour, sugar, and Baileys.
  • Bold overmixing: Mixing the dough too much can lead to tough cookies. Mix until just combined for a softer texture.
  • Bold skipping chilling: Not chilling the dough can cause spreading. Chill the dough for at least 30 minutes before baking.
  • Bold forgetting to preheat: Baking in an unheated oven can affect cooking times. Preheat your oven to the correct temperature before baking.
  • Bold using stale ingredients: Old baking powder or chocolate chips can impact flavor. Always check the freshness of your ingredients.

Storage & Reheating Instructions

Refrigerator Storage

  • item Store cookies in an airtight container for up to 5 days.
  • item Keep parchment paper between layers to prevent sticking.

Freezing Baileys Irish Cream Chocolate Chip Cookies

  • item Freeze cookies individually on a baking sheet before transferring to a freezer bag.
  • item They can be stored in the freezer for up to 3 months.

Reheating Baileys Irish Cream Chocolate Chip Cookies

  • Bold Oven: Preheat to 350°F (175°C) and bake for about 5 minutes.
  • Bold Microwave: Heat one cookie at a time for about 10-15 seconds until warm.
  • Bold Stovetop: Place on a skillet over low heat for a few minutes until warmed through.

Frequently Asked Questions

What makes Baileys Irish Cream Chocolate Chip Cookies special?

These cookies combine rich chocolate chips with the creamy flavor of Baileys Irish Cream, offering a unique twist on classic chocolate chip cookies.

Can I substitute Baileys in the recipe?

Yes, you can use other cream liqueurs or even omit it entirely if preferred. Just adjust the liquid content accordingly.

How do I make gluten-free Baileys Irish Cream Chocolate Chip Cookies?

You can substitute all-purpose flour with a gluten-free blend that measures cup-for-cup. Ensure other ingredients are gluten-free as well.

How long do these cookies last?

Baileys Irish Cream Chocolate Chip Cookies typically last about 5 days at room temperature and up to 3 months in the freezer when stored properly.
